On October 31, 2023, this electrifying KISS tribute album will hit digital media and CD, making Halloween the ultimate night for KISS fans. And what’s even better, the proceeds from “BRC II” will go to support the Maria Love Fund, a 501(c)3 charitable organization providing immediate financial assistance to those in need.
For lifelong KISS fan and founder/guitarist of KISS THIS!, John Jeffrey, this project is a labor of love. He’s once again gathered an impressive lineup of artists, primarily representing the Western New York music scene. The album features both original “Buffalo Rock City” alumni and newcomers to the studio project, promising a blend of classic and fresh talent.
Returning to the “Buffalo Rock City II” album are iconic bands KISS THIS! and DoDriver. Notably, DoDriver was handpicked by KISS and their manager, Doc McGhee, to open for KISS on the Sonic Boom tour in 2010, a testament to their rock prowess.
But that’s not all; the album boasts an impressive lineup of international rock artists. The star-studded cast includes John Corabi, Jeff Scott Soto, John Gioeli, Jean Beauvoir, Tommy Henriksen, Tommy Denander, Howie Simon, Rafael Moreira, Deen Castronovo, Steve Blaze, Philip Shouse, Dave Comer, Mitch Weissman, and many more. These “celebrity guests” have graced stages and studios with some of the biggest names in rock history.
A notable highlight is the return of Mitch Weissman, who sang on the original “Buffalo Rock City” album. He’s back with his co-write with Gene Simmons, “What You See Is What You Get,” a song that was originally demoed for KISS’ 1987 album “Crazy Nights.” It’s a blast from the past brought back to life.
Jean Beauvoir, a significant figure in KISStory, also plays a vital role, recording a brand new version of “Who Wants To Be Lonely,” a song he originally contributed to KISS’ 1985 release, “Asylum.”
The album’s production is in capable hands, having been mixed by C.Wood and David Julian. Kevin Conrad, the comic artist known for his work on Todd McFarlane’s “KISS – Psycho Circus” comic book series, has created stunning cover art for “BRC II.” This new artwork pays homage to the iconic KISS “Love Gun” album cover and features Buffalo’s Albright Knox Art Gallery as the centerpiece.
Unlike its predecessor, “Buffalo Rock City II” is all about love-themed KISS songs, bringing a different dimension to the KISS experience.

“Buffalo Rock City II” Tracklist:
- “I Stole Your Love ’89” (Johnny Gioeli & Howie Simon)
- “Saint And Sinner” (DoDriver)
- “Who Wants To Be Lonely” (Jean Beauvoir)
- “Down On Your Knees” (John Corabi)
- “Have Love Will Travel/Got Love For Sale” (Dave Comer)
- “Tomorrow and Tonight” (Dave Comer)
- “Love For Sale” (Billy Sheehan & Jeff Scott Soto)
- “Calling Dr. Love” (KISS THIS!)
- “Makin’ Love” (KISS THIS!)
- “Save Your Love” (Tommy Henriksen & Philip Shouse)
- “Love Gun” (Deen Castronovo & Rafael Moreira)
- “Shoot U Full Of Love” (Various artists)
- “Exciter” (Dave Comer)
- “You Love Me To Hate You” (Steve Blaze)
- “I” (Dave Comer & Tommy Denander)
- “Hell Or High Water” (Various artists)
- “What You See Is What You Get” (Mitch Weissman)
